Rookie Sensation: Puka Nacua Shines in Debut Season

In a debut season that has already made waves across the NFL, Puka Nacua has demonstrated why he's one of the most promising young talents to enter the league in recent years. With a combination of natural skill, resilience, and the ability to learn quickly, Nacua has cemented his place in the Los Angeles Rams' offense alongside veterans like Matthew Stafford and Cooper Kupp. Nacua's exceptional ability was on full display in his first two professional games, where he caught 25 passes for an impressive 266 yards. This immediate impact hinted at what was to come, and Nacua did not disappoint. Over the course of the season, he set rookie records for receptions (105) and receiving yards (1,486), a testament to his consistency and talent. "I wouldn't use the word surprised, but it definitely did feel natural," Nacua reflected on his early success. "My first target in the NFL was a drop, but... everything else went so smoothly after that. So it was amazing." Indeed, Nacua's smooth transition into the NFL can be attributed to not only his innate skill but also the strong support system around him. Central to this is veteran quarterback Matthew Stafford, whose leadership both on and off the field has been invaluable to Nacua. "There's nobody I'd rather have leading our offense than Matthew Stafford," Nacua shared. "He's tough as nails, he can put the ball anywhere he wants... he's so smart and witty, but he also takes the time to care and pour into his other teammates." This mentorship has evidently paid off. Nacua earned Second Team All-Pro honors and made a Pro Bowl appearance in his rookie season. By the end of the year, he was ranked ninth in receptions, fourth in yards, and sixth in receiving yards per game, highlighting his role as a pivotal player in the Rams' offense. However, Nacua's journey wasn't without its challenges. A particularly tough matchup against the Cowboys, where he faced Stephon Gilmore, was a learning experience. "The game against the Cowboys, Stephon Gilmore was a tough one," Nacua admitted. "It wasn't my best performance, but it was something I was able to learn from and I'm super excited for that matchup whenever it comes again." Learning and adapting seem to be recurring themes for Nacua. Veteran wide receiver Cooper Kupp has also played a crucial role in Nacua's development, imparting lessons about patience and understanding the game. "Patience was one of the big things," Nacua noted. "Coop is such a calm and centered guy, so the patience that he's able to have in the route-running and understanding the offense and seeing the defense was something I tried to continually add into my game." Nacua's standout performance in the wild card playoff game against the Detroit Lions further illustrated his growth and potential. Catching nine passes for 181 yards and a touchdown, he set the NFL record for the most receiving yards by a rookie in a playoff game. Despite this extraordinary achievement, the Rams lost the game to the Lions, underlining the competitive nature of NFL playoffs.
